Vincent Phantomhive was the previous head of the Phantomhive family. He was known for his striking appearance, gentle manners, and the beauty mark below his left eye. Even though he seemed kind, he could be very cold and clever when working as the Queen’s Watchdog. Vincent cared deeply for his close ones, but did not show much interest in people who were not useful to him. He was killed along with his wife Rachel and servants in a mysterious attack that left his mansion in ruins. His actions and influence still shape the story as people remember his legacy.
Vincent Phantomhive had brunette, dark blue hair and a noticeable beauty mark under his left eye. He was known for his gentle, calm look and beautiful features.
Vincent was generally gentle and polite.
However, he could be very cold and serious when he worked as the Queen’s Watchdog.
He liked to use sarcasm when talking with people close to him.
Vincent did not pay attention to people who could not benefit him.
Vincent was the previous Earl of Phantomhive and the father of Ciel Phantomhive.
He met Rachel Phantomhive through her father, and they later got married.
Vincent enjoyed a happy life with his family until the tragic night of their murder.
Three years before the main story, an unknown attacker killed Vincent, his wife Rachel, and their servants, and set their mansion on fire.
Vincent was very skilled in solving problems and running secret missions as the Queen’s Watchdog.
He was clever enough to control others for his goals, including his old school rival, Diederich.

The Murder of Vincent Phantomhive
Three years before the main story, Vincent, his wife Rachel, and their servants were killed by unknown people.
The attackers set the mansion on fire, and their bodies were burned along with the house.
Vincent’s Time at Weston College
Vincent attended Weston College and became the prefect of the Sapphire Owl House.
Even though his house was not good at sports, Vincent cleverly led them to victory in a cricket tournament.
He did this by outsmarting Diederich, who was the prefect of the Jade Lion House.
This win was called the "Azure Miracle" and is still talked about at the school when Ciel Phantomhive visits.
Vincent’s Fate in the Anime
In the anime, Vincent’s death is even sadder.
Angela Blanc killed Vincent and stitched his face together with his wife Rachel’s face.
Angela also used Vincent’s body as a puppet and made him the leader of a strange cult.
Ciel did not know it was his father, and Vincent was finally killed when Sebastian Michaelis threw a knife at his head.
After that, Angela caused the church to collapse, burying Vincent under rubble.
